摘要

Abstract

The article explores the methods for genetic engineering modification of microbial metabolic pathways and its practical applications in industrial and pharmaceutical production.By analyzing the current status and challenges of microbial metabolic pathways,the necessity and potential advantages of genetic engineering modification are pointed out,and the gene cloning and expression system,metabolic pathway regulation strategy,and high-throughput technology are introduced in detail.In addition,practical application cases demonstrate the significant effectiveness of genetic engineering in increasing the production of glutamate and penicillin.
